168348 tn?1379357075 Is the 2009 H1N1 influenza vaccine safe for pregnant women? A: Influenza vaccines have not been shown to cause harm to a pregnant woman or her baby. The seasonal flu shot (injection) is proven as safe and already recommended for pregnant women. The 2009 H1N1 influenza vaccine will be made using the same processes and facilities that are used to make seasonal influenza vaccines.

151928 tn?1275707337 It is important for a pregnant woman to receive the 2009 H1N1 influenza vaccine as well as a seasonal influenza vaccine. A pregnant woman who gets any type of flu is at risk for serious complications and hospitalization. Pregnant women who are otherwise healthy have been severely impacted by the 2009 H1N1 influenza virus (formerly called “novel H1N1 flu” or “swine flu”).

179856 tn?1333547362 t related to the flu vaccine. In fact, there were no deaths attributed to the H1N1 vaccine last year, Gunter says. Myth 4: Only sick people need a flu shot. While older people and newborns are usually at greatest risk for complications, swine flu is actually most threatening to the young. Typically, about 90% of flu deaths are in people over 65. Last year, however, about 90% of flu deaths were in people under 30. About 10% of flu deaths last year were in children, according to the CDC.

147426 tn?1317265632 Every year the vaccine manufacturers have just a few months to come up with the vaccine for the prediction that year. H1N1 popped up out of nowhere in the early summer. Yes, the testing of this vaccine was rushed, but the process to make it is tried and true. The swine flu is pretty new to the human species. Apparently it appeared a decade or so ago. So few of us have any resistance to it. Because of this more people will catch it and those that do may have a more severe disease.
